The clutch engagement on my 2021 cforce 400s was approx 2700 RPM, very abrupt/not smooth. I obtained a "kit" from RNG consisting of a blue painted spring (spring force unknown) with 12 gram weights, as measured on my postal scale. Installation was easy; 18 mm and 30 mm (not 32 mm as seen on other writings) impact sockets for clutch housing removal. The resultant clutch engagement was still up to approx 2500 and very abupt/not smooth.
The original spring was labeled p/n 0951-1021 (specs for spring force 300/1600) with 18 gram weights.
I called RNG who told me the kit should work fine for my ATV, but that wasn't the case as I found.
The RNG spring was slightly longer than the stock spring, but felt slightly easier at initial downward force but had more resistance than stock as I continued to push down. RNG would not tell me what the spring force was.
I then tested the clutch with the RNG spring and the OEM 18 gram weights with the resultant engagement RPM of about 2050 RPM, a little smoother engagement but still not good.
I am really struggling to get any answers on the best combination of spring / weights to achieve a smooth engagement of maybe 1800 RPM. Note; idle RPM is approx. 1600.
I have searched all the forums and cannot find good information, and RNG appears to be not willing to share information. What gives here? Anyone with experience to share?
